As part of the Global Wind Day activities, WindEurope and the Global Wind Energy Council (GWEC) have launched a global photo competition: “Future Wind.”

Creativity, content, composition and technique as well as a compelling story behind your photograph are the key criteria for the judges.

Submit your photos

The four categories are:

  • People and Wind
  • Working in Wind
  • Beautiful Wind
  • Beyond Wind

Win €1,000 in cash!

The first prize winner from each category will receive €1,000. In addition, the winning photographs will be displayed across both WindEurope and GWEC’s channels.

The deadline for submissions is Wednesday, 5 June 2019 (23:55 CEST).
